📄 xfcn6a.m
字号:
function PI = xfcn6a(x)
global KAV KNA KVF Mass KBEMF Emin COL DZO
KAV=x(1); KNA=x(2); KVF=x(3); Mass=x(4); KBEMF=x(5);
COL=x(6); DZO=x(7);
KBEMF=0; %Mass=1.5;
MDL='hong2000';
[T X Y]=sim(MDL,[0 1.5]);
E=Y(:,1); STP=sum(Y(:,2));
if STP>=1
Err=10000;
fprintf('>');
else
Err=E(length(E));
if Emin>Err
fprintf('S');
Emin=Err;
save xxx
fprintf('\nKAV=%.2f; KNA=%.2f; KVF=%.6f;\n',KAV,KNA,KVF);
fprintf('Mass=%.6f; KBE=%.2f; \n',Mass,KBEMF);
fprintf('COL=%.6f; DZO=%.2f; Err=%10.6f;\n',COL,DZO,Err);
end;
end;
PI=10000-Err;
⌨️ 快捷键说明
复制代码
Ctrl + C
搜索代码
Ctrl + F
全屏模式
F11
切换主题
Ctrl + Shift + D
显示快捷键
?
增大字号
Ctrl + =
减小字号
Ctrl + -